Set in 1890s Paris, this gothic tale follows a disfigured musical prodigy living beneath the Palais Garnier opera house who becomes obsessed with a young opera singer. Suitable for middle-grade readers, the story explores themes of love, mystery, and identity, with some scary and suspenseful moments typical of horror fiction. Parents should note the presence of eerie and intense scenes that contribute to the story's gothic atmosphere.
Why we rated Phantom of the Opera 11ME
Phantom of the Opera is written at a Level 6 reading level across 286 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 7.0 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Phantom of the Opera works for readers up to grade 8.0.
We rate Phantom of the Opera as 11ME ("Moderate — Emotional") because the content sits in the "Moderate" range — moderate conflict that may involve loss, scary scenes, or interpersonal stakes. The strongest signals come from emotional weight, thematic difficulty — these are the dimensions parents should evaluate against their reader's tolerance.
No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the moderate intensity score.
Thematically, Phantom of the Opera explores gothic, mystery, music, identity & self-discovery, and historical —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
